Nature Meets Sculpture

Live tree in pot, cardboard, collage, paint, paper mache, rocks, wood, varnish

I grew a tree from an unknown seed I found. Art grew from the observation of nature, but this relationship has never been explicit My sculpture brings to light this observation.

As a lifelong artist, I continue to create daily which keeps me young at age 100. I received art degrees in Fine Arts and Art History at US Berkeley, Long Beach, and USC, and have exhibited and taught extensively in the US and Australia.
